Jump aboard the 'Aquador' and experience a real fishes-eye-view under the crystal clear waters around Goat Island Marine Reserve.
Departing from the beautiful beach at Goat Island Marine Reserve, near Leigh, these short excursions around the surrounding reefs, caves and bays are a fantastic way to get really up close and personal with the amazing array of marine wildlife to be seen in these waters.
The unique vantage point the glass-bottomed boat offers passengers, provides unrivalled photo opportunities, and is a particular source of wonder for kids (and big kids!), who will never have seen fish, molluscs, urchins and seabirds this close before.
If you're lucky, you may even see some dolphins, who are known to follow the boat as it winds its way in and out of the echoey caves and around the bay, and no two trips are the same.
Stingrays, leatherjackets, beautiful blue maomao and marblefish are just some of the slippery customers you'll encounter, as well as a whole host of surprisingly attractive mosses, kelps, and anemones. Watching all this incredible marine life go about their business through the glass floor of the boat, is a truly awesome sight, and the next best thing to actually being down there with them.
